TESTING THE MIXING VALVE

After installation, test the Mixing Valve and the faucet it 
serves for proper operation by following the steps below.

Valve temperature test procedure is as follows:

1. Activate faucet to observe and record the temperature with a stick 
Thermometer. If the temperature of the Thermometer is not correct, 
readjust the Mixing Valve according to the section “Setting the Mixing 
Valve”.

9 REPLACING THE THERMOSTATIC ELEMENT

The Thermostatic Element’s replacement procedure is
as follows:

1. Shut off the hot water supply and cold water supply to the Mixing Valve.

2. Remove the Plastic Cap and disassemble the Valve Cap.

3. Remove Thermostatic Element in conjunction with the Shuttle from the
    Valve Body. No special tools are required.

4. Inspect the Thermostatic Element. If it feels slippery to the touch,
    then the Element has lost its wax and requires replacement. If the
    Thermostatic Element feels normal to the touch, then it is in good
    condition and operable.

5. Verify that the stainless steel Piston moves freely up and down within
    the Element’s body. 

Note:

Gallon per minute ratings may 

vary depending upon incoming 

water temperatures and 

pressures. Hot and cold water 

inlet pressures must be equal.

Provisions shall be made to 

thermally isolate the valve.

NOTES:

COMPLIANCE:

ASSE 1070 & cUPC Certified

• Inlets: 3/8” Compression Male Threads

• Outlet: 3/8” Compression Male Threads

• 

Maximum Working Pressure: 125 psi (861.9 kPa)

• Rated flow at 30 psi (206.9 kPa) differential

   pressure: 2.16 GPM (8.2 L/min)

• Minimum flow rate: 0.35 GPM (1.3 L/min)

• 

Hot Water Inlet Temperature Range: 120° – 180° F

• 

Cold Water Inlet Temperature Range: 37° – 80° F

• Outlet Water 

Temperature Range: 80° – 120° F

• 

Minimum Temperature Differential (Hot to Mix):

  18° F (10° C)

Contractor to supply necessary inlet 
connections.
